#4438be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4438be is composed of 26.7% red, 22%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 70.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 245.4 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 48.2%. #4438be color hex could be obtained by blending #8870ff with #00007d.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#4438be

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030208 is the darkest color, while #f8f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4438be

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7a7c is the less saturated color, while #1d09ed is the most saturated one.
